Ernest Renan was a French philosopher. According to him, following are the attributes of a nation:
1. A nation is the culmination of a long past of endeavors, scarifies and devotion.
2. The idea of a nation is based upon the social capita which is the heroic past, great men and glory.
3. Nation is formed of people who have performed great deeds in past and wish to perform more of them.
4. Nation is a large – scale solidarity among its people.
5. In a nation only its inhabitants have the right to be consulted.
6. A nation does not annex or hold onto a control against its will.
According to Renan, nations are important as they guarantee liberty to one and all.

=> Terminal has the built- in ability to theme your shell windows, but you 'd never no it by looking at the default white screen.
Navigate to "Terminal -> Preferences" from Terminal's menu bar.

In the prefences window select the "profiles" tab. These options will adjust the appearance of a new Terminal windows.

Adjustable appearance settings include background and text color, text rendering options, text size and typeface, cursor type, selection color, and ANSI colors. ANSI colors are used when a Terminal command displays colored output but won't appear otherwise.
You'll notice a number of prepre-existing profiles in the menu on the left pane. You can choose one of these or click the "+" button at the bottom of the pane to create a new profile. Profiles are the containers for your settings, so you may want to create a personal profile before tweaking anything.

When ready, set your new profile as your default by clicking the "Default" button at the bottom of the profile pane. All new Terminal windows will now open in this profile.

You can also open Terminal windows in a specific profile from "Shell -> New Window," which allows you to select the profile for the new shell.

Login Commands
Terminal can run specific shell commands when a shell window is open. These can be assigned on a per- profile basis, so different profiles execute different commands.
Open Terminal's preference window from "Terminal -> Preference," and click on the "Shell" tab.
